In an obvious homage to Joseph Conrad's Heart of Darkness, Dr. Marina Singh is asked to travel to the most remote jungles of the Amazon by the pharaceutical company for which she works for two reasons. The first is to recover the remains of her research partner, Dr. Anders Eckman, who died there and also to get a status report on the research being conducted by Dr. Annick Swenson.
